Gumbo to Geaux is a chef-driven food truck (and catering and events company) – in every sense.

Owner and founder Etricia Robinson, a classically trained chef, is driven to offer the authentic country-Creole dishes she grew up eating.

“If Emeril Lagasse and Paula Deen had a baby,” she says, “it’d be me, because I do Cajun-Creole plus Southern and all the love that goes into cooking. It’s a labor of love, but it’s my business.”
